antus wrote:In order to use it, you will need a couple of virtual com port pairs, as well either a built in serial port, or a usb -> serial converter that supports the non-standard 8192 baud rate required.

prolific chipset usb -> serial adaptors are known NOT to work (and these are the cheapest most common type) and FTDI chipset devices are known to be good. You can check what you have by right clicking on the com port and choosing properites. If it says prolific you are probably out of luck. If it says FTDI you are good to go.
comport type.jpg
All these com ports should be numbered between 1 and 9. You will need to use device manager, check your com ports and make sure you have enough space for 4 new ones on top of the one for the ecu connection within this range. If you do not you can right click on any of the extra ports, click advanced and change the port number to 10 or above. Once you have sorted this out reboot.

bad news prolific cant do 8192 baud, it will say ok then do 9600 with comms errors :(
